.product-hero[data-astro-cid-ockwzmc7]{padding:6rem 1.5rem;text-align:center;background-color:var(--color-bg-surface);border-bottom:1px solid var(--color-border)}.hero-container[data-astro-cid-ockwzmc7]{max-width:800px;margin:0 auto}.back-link[data-astro-cid-ockwzmc7]{display:inline-flex;align-items:center;gap:.5rem;color:var(--color-text-muted);text-decoration:none;font-weight:500;margin-bottom:3rem;transition:color .2s}.back-link[data-astro-cid-ockwzmc7]:hover{color:var(--color-primary)}.badge-wrapper[data-astro-cid-ockwzmc7]{margin-bottom:1.5rem}.ultimate-badge[data-astro-cid-ockwzmc7]{display:inline-block;padding:.4rem 1rem;background-color:#8b5cf61a;color:#8b5cf6;border:1px solid rgba(139,92,246,.2);border-radius:999px;font-size:.85rem;font-weight:700;text-transform:uppercase;letter-spacing:.05em}.hero-title[data-astro-cid-ockwzmc7]{font-size:clamp(3rem,8vw,4.5rem);font-weight:900;margin:0 0 1.5rem;letter-spacing:-.04em;color:var(--color-text-main)}.text-highlight[data-astro-cid-ockwzmc7]{color:var(--color-primary)}.hero-subtitle[data-astro-cid-ockwzmc7]{font-size:1.2rem;line-height:1.7;color:var(--color-text-muted);margin-bottom:2.5rem}.hero-actions[data-astro-cid-ockwzmc7]{display:flex;justify-content:center}.btn[data-astro-cid-ockwzmc7]{display:inline-flex;align-items:center;gap:.5rem;justify-content:center;padding:.875rem 1.75rem;font-weight:600;font-size:1rem;border-radius:var(--radius-md);text-decoration:none;transition:all .2s ease;cursor:pointer}.btn-primary[data-astro-cid-ockwzmc7]{background-color:#8b5cf6;color:#fff;border:1px solid #8b5cf6;box-shadow:0 4px 14px #8b5cf64d}.btn-primary[data-astro-cid-ockwzmc7]:hover{background-color:#7c3aed;border-color:#7c3aed;transform:translateY(-2px)}@media (max-width: 768px){.product-hero[data-astro-cid-ockwzmc7]{padding:4rem 1.5rem}}.heavy-features[data-astro-cid-6rkgx53h]{padding:6rem 0;background-color:var(--color-bg-base)}.heavy-grid[data-astro-cid-6rkgx53h]{display:grid;grid-template-columns:repeat(auto-fit,minmax(320px,1fr));gap:2rem}.heavy-card[data-astro-cid-6rkgx53h]{background-color:var(--color-bg-surface);padding:3rem 2.5rem;border-radius:var(--radius-lg);border:1px solid var(--color-border);position:relative;box-shadow:var(--shadow-sm);transition:transform .2s ease,border-color .2s ease}.heavy-card[data-astro-cid-6rkgx53h]:hover{transform:translateY(-5px);border-color:#8b5cf6;box-shadow:var(--shadow-md)}.heavy-card[data-astro-cid-6rkgx53h] .card-icon[data-astro-cid-6rkgx53h]{display:inline-flex;align-items:center;justify-content:center;width:4rem;height:4rem;background-color:var(--color-bg-elevated);border:1px solid var(--color-border);border-radius:var(--radius-md);color:#8b5cf6;font-size:1.75rem;margin-bottom:1.5rem;box-shadow:0 4px 10px #8b5cf633}.heavy-card[data-astro-cid-6rkgx53h] h3[data-astro-cid-6rkgx53h]{font-size:1.4rem;color:var(--color-text-main);margin:0 0 1rem;font-weight:700}.heavy-card[data-astro-cid-6rkgx53h] p[data-astro-cid-6rkgx53h]{color:var(--color-text-muted);line-height:1.6;margin:0}.heavy-card[data-astro-cid-6rkgx53h] strong[data-astro-cid-6rkgx53h]{color:var(--color-text-main)}.features-deep-dive[data-astro-cid-emhburvm]{padding:6rem 0;background-color:var(--color-bg-surface);border-top:1px solid var(--color-border);border-bottom:1px solid var(--color-border)}.deep-dive-grid[data-astro-cid-emhburvm]{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:3rem 2rem}.feature-card[data-astro-cid-emhburvm]{padding:1rem}.feature-card[data-astro-cid-emhburvm] .card-icon[data-astro-cid-emhburvm]{font-size:2rem;color:var(--color-text-main);opacity:.8;margin-bottom:1.5rem}.feature-card[data-astro-cid-emhburvm] h3[data-astro-cid-emhburvm]{font-size:1.25rem;color:var(--color-text-main);margin-bottom:1rem;font-weight:700}.feature-card[data-astro-cid-emhburvm] p[data-astro-cid-emhburvm]{color:var(--color-text-muted);line-height:1.6;margin:0;font-size:.95rem}.editions-section[data-astro-cid-2xeebzf4]{padding:6rem 0;background-color:var(--color-bg-base)}.trial-banner[data-astro-cid-2xeebzf4]{display:flex;align-items:center;gap:1.5rem;background-color:var(--color-bg-surface);border:1px solid #8b5cf6;border-radius:var(--radius-lg);padding:1.5rem 2rem;margin-bottom:4rem;box-shadow:0 10px 30px -10px #8b5cf633}.trial-banner-icon[data-astro-cid-2xeebzf4]{font-size:2.5rem;color:#8b5cf6}.trial-banner-text[data-astro-cid-2xeebzf4]{flex:1}.trial-banner-text[data-astro-cid-2xeebzf4] h4[data-astro-cid-2xeebzf4]{margin:0 0 .25rem;color:var(--color-text-main);font-size:1.1rem;font-weight:700}.trial-banner-text[data-astro-cid-2xeebzf4] p[data-astro-cid-2xeebzf4]{margin:0;color:var(--color-text-muted);font-size:.95rem;line-height:1.5}.trial-banner-text[data-astro-cid-2xeebzf4] strong[data-astro-cid-2xeebzf4]{color:var(--color-text-main)}.btn[data-astro-cid-2xeebzf4]{display:inline-flex;align-items:center;justify-content:center;font-weight:600;border-radius:var(--radius-md);text-decoration:none;transition:all .2s ease;cursor:pointer}.btn-outline[data-astro-cid-2xeebzf4]{background-color:transparent;color:var(--color-text-main);border:1px solid var(--color-border)}.btn-outline[data-astro-cid-2xeebzf4]:hover{border-color:var(--color-text-muted);background-color:var(--color-bg-elevated);transform:translateY(-2px)}.btn-sm[data-astro-cid-2xeebzf4]{padding:.6rem 1.25rem;font-size:.9rem;white-space:nowrap}.editions-grid[data-astro-cid-2xeebzf4]{display:grid;grid-template-columns:repeat(auto-fit,minmax(320px,1fr));gap:3rem}.edition-column[data-astro-cid-2xeebzf4]{display:flex;flex-direction:column;gap:1.5rem}.column-header[data-astro-cid-2xeebzf4]{margin-bottom:1rem}.column-header[data-astro-cid-2xeebzf4] h3[data-astro-cid-2xeebzf4]{font-size:1.4rem;color:var(--color-text-main);margin:0 0 .5rem}.column-header[data-astro-cid-2xeebzf4] p[data-astro-cid-2xeebzf4]{color:var(--color-text-muted);margin:0;font-size:.95rem;line-height:1.5}.edition-card[data-astro-cid-2xeebzf4]{display:flex;align-items:center;justify-content:space-between;padding:1.5rem;background-color:var(--color-bg-surface);border:1px solid var(--color-border);border-radius:var(--radius-md);text-decoration:none;transition:all .2s ease;box-shadow:var(--shadow-sm)}.edition-card[data-astro-cid-2xeebzf4]:hover{transform:translateY(-3px);border-color:#8b5cf6;box-shadow:var(--shadow-md)}.edition-card[data-astro-cid-2xeebzf4].highlight{border:1px solid #8b5cf6;background-color:var(--color-bg-elevated)}.card-content[data-astro-cid-2xeebzf4] h4[data-astro-cid-2xeebzf4]{margin:0;color:var(--color-text-main);font-size:1.05rem;font-weight:600;display:flex;align-items:center;gap:.75rem}.badge[data-astro-cid-2xeebzf4]{background-color:#8b5cf6;color:#fff;font-size:.7rem;padding:.2rem .5rem;border-radius:999px;font-weight:700;text-transform:uppercase}.diff-badge[data-astro-cid-2xeebzf4]{background-color:#10b981}.edition-card[data-astro-cid-2xeebzf4] i[data-astro-cid-2xeebzf4]{color:#8b5cf6;font-size:1.2rem;transition:transform .2s ease}.edition-card[data-astro-cid-2xeebzf4]:hover i[data-astro-cid-2xeebzf4]{transform:translate(4px)}@media (max-width: 1024px){.ultimate-pricing[data-astro-cid-2xeebzf4]{grid-template-columns:1fr;gap:4rem}.edition-column[data-astro-cid-2xeebzf4]:not(:first-child){padding-top:3rem;border-top:1px dashed var(--color-border)}}@media (max-width: 768px){.trial-banner[data-astro-cid-2xeebzf4]{flex-direction:column;text-align:center;padding:1.5rem}}.content-container{max-width:1200px;margin:0 auto;padding:0 1.5rem}.section-header{text-align:center;margin-bottom:4rem}.section-header h2{font-size:2.2rem;color:var(--color-text-main);margin-bottom:1rem;font-weight:700;letter-spacing:-.02em}.section-header p{font-size:1.15rem;color:var(--color-text-muted);max-width:700px;margin:0 auto;line-height:1.6}
